Transaction 63830bfdeaf4ee3b4a7ef65fa2f677a4aabad00abcdeafa4f663de4f88020611
1 Input
1 Outputs
- 63830bfdeaf4ee3b4a7ef65fa2f677a4aabad00abcdeafa4f663de4f88020611:0
value 328244
address 39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P